Whenever I hover over or highlight files with a certain
extension, mainly .mod, .xm, or .s3m, which are types of
music files, Explorer.exe immediately crashes. I have
never seen such a bizarre bug before. Anyone know
anything about this? This only started happening
recently, and the only thing i've done of note is install
some windows updates.

My guess is you have some media-related shell extensions installed,
which are causing the crash. An example of this would be a third-party
media player.
